Can you help me?: I help individuals who are experiencing the weight of anxiety reclaim peace, confidence, and a sense of control. If you feel stuck in cycles of overthinking, people-pleasing, or panic and overwhelm, I can help you learn to set boundaries, reduce self-doubt, and move toward a more grounded, empowered life. Whether you're in the middle of a transition or simply feeling overwhelmed, you're not alone, and change is possible.
I work with young adults and teens who are navigating identity, building confidence, and processing anxiety or past trauma. Many are going through major life transitions such as graduating, entering the workforce, or adjusting to post-college life, and are looking for clarity and direction. I offer a space to explore who you are, where you're headed, and how to manage what life throws your way.
I specialize in working with athletes both in and outside of their sport, helping them strengthen their mental game, manage performance anxiety, and develop healthy self-talk and habits. Whether you're facing a tough season, struggling with superstition or burnout, or transitioning into life beyond athletics, I offer a space where you can explore who you are and how you want to show up in sport and in life.
I support adults facing trauma, grief, and betrayal. Whether you’re healing from the pain of relational trauma or navigating a significant loss, I use EMDR and parts work to help process and release the emotional weight of these experiences. Together, we’ll work to rebuild safety, trust, and wholeness from the inside out."
Experience/ Education: I am an EMDR-trained therapist who integrates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Internal Family Systems (IFS), and a trauma-informed approach to support lasting emotional and mental change. I earned my Master’s in Clinical Mental Health Counseling from Mercer University, and I am deeply committed to helping clients feel safe, seen, and empowered in therapy. My style is warm, collaborative, and compassionate. I believe healing begins when we feel understood and supported."
